How do I convert moles to atoms manually?
Multiply the number of moles by Avogadro's number (6.02214076 × 10²³) to find the equivalent number of atoms. For example, 2 moles multiplied by Avogadro's number yields approximately 1.204 × 10²⁴ atoms.

What exactly is a mole in chemistry?
A mole is a base unit in the International System of Units (SI) that represents exactly 6.02214076 × 10²³ elementary entities, such as atoms, ions, or molecules. It allows chemists to count particles by weighing them.
